Be our guest - pre-park checkin
 
Just wondering how this works - done it before but forgot...

Am I right in thinking you go to the entrance and scan your band to confirm you have a reservation and then give you some sort of ticket to show at the cast member guarding the entrance to Fantasy land ?

Mexy02 4 Dec 19 08:27 PM

Go down to the castle and you will find cms with iPads the will direct you to be our guest . As everyone can go down Main Street now before opening that’s where the ropes are .

sha9 5 Dec 19 07:30 AM

No ticket, you just get your band scanned a second time. Only one person in the party needs to do it though if I remember right. That may be just for EMH though.

Yorkie Girl 6 Dec 19 09:44 AM

We had a reservation for 8am on a 9am opening day. We got through bag check etc at 7.40am and, after having my band scanned, were held just to the left of the railway station until 7.45am when they opened Main Street for everyone (they let us in first). They gave us a leaflet to show where 2nd checkin was for each restaurant. BOG is just near liberty square bridge, and they then let you round the side of the castle.

Actually, thinking back (about 2weeks :blush:) our ADR wasn’t until 8.20am, but we went straight to BOG and were sat down straight away (well, once through the initial queue to pay).

When I last went in May 2018 (8am breakfast) after passing the first set of cast members there was two queues. One to the right to order and pay for food and one to the left which was pre-ordered guests.

There was no queue to the left and a huge queue to the right. I can imagine during really busy time the queue on the left might for to a handful of mins but nothing like the queue to the right where people are ordering.

So I am presuming if YG found a huge queue at 8:20 they are almost certainly referring to the right hand queue and not the left hand queue for pre-ordered customers.
